I would like to use a Sipgate Basic VOIP account with my BT FTTP connection but the supplied Smart Hub 2 doesn't seem to allow this. It seems that BT only allow you to use their own Digital Voice service . Can anyone please suggest either a workaround that will enable me to do this or a decent (but not too expensive) third party router that can do it? Thanks.

Smart hub 2 only works with BT digital voice phones directly but you can get yourself an ATA box like these
https://www.amazon.co.uk/voip-phone-adapter/s?k=voip+phone+adapter and configure to use with Sipgate and connect to SH2
